Adding bookmarks using the printer control panel Note: Bookmarks added from the printer control panel must be edited from the printer Embedded Web Server. 1 From the printer control panel, navigate to: Forms and Favorites > Create Bookmark 2 Enter a name for the new bookmark, and then touch Enter. This name will be displayed in the Forms menu when selecting a form to print. 3 Select Network, FTP, HTTP, or HTTPS to specify the network location or the protocol of the bookmark, and then touch Submit. 4 Choose an authentication option, or enter the URL or network location of the form. Note: The printer does not verify the validity of the URL or network location. Make sure the location is entered correctly. 5 Touch . Adding bookmarks using the Embedded Web Server 1 From the Embedded Web Server, click Settings or Configuration. 2 Click Device Solutions > Solutions (eSF), or click Embedded Solutions. 3 Click the name of the application, and then click Add under the Bookmarks field. Note: You can also edit or delete a bookmark. 4 In the Name field, type a new bookmark name. 5 From the Location list, select the protocol or specify if it is located in a network folder. You may choose Network, FTP, HTTP, or HTTPS. 6 In the PIN field, type a four-digit number. This field is optional and will require users to enter a PIN when printing the bookmark. 7 Type the network address, the network domain name, the port, or the URL based on the location of the bookmark specified in Step 4. 8 Under Authentication Options, select whether to require user authentication for this destination.
